Tentang

33–36 cm. Small gadfly petrel; grey-brown above with white underparts and partial dark breast-band. Critically Endangered; breeds only on Madeira's high central mountains (fewer than 65 pairs). Threatened by light pollution, introduced predators. Long-distance migrations to Atlantic.
